Output e9051039285d42d84474e0dc18b62dce71b43b03e1858fa8e76adf0574d5724b:15

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b527e6315cdb7c488a986d21b425f05a8bdcbb2a984be1d910ebefa72419e2b0
address
bc1pk5n7vv2umd7y3z5cd5smgf0st29aewe2np97rkgsa0h6wfqeu2cqmsy5we
transaction
e9051039285d42d84474e0dc18b62dce71b43b03e1858fa8e76adf0574d5724b
spent
true